The extensive gardens at Southwick House comprise three main areas.
The first is a traditional formal walled garden with potager and large glasshouse producing a range of fruit, vegetables and cutting flowers.
Adjacent to this is a hedged formal garden with herbaceous, shrub and rose beds centred around a lily pond, with roses being a notable feature.
Outwith the formal gardens there is a large water garden with two connected ponds with trees, shrubs and lawns running alongside the Southwick Burn.This is a fundraising event for the open garden charity Scotland’s Gardens Scheme which raises money for hundreds of local charities.
